BART LAB Represents Thailand at ACCAS 2025 in Japan

29 September 2025 – Kyushu, Japan

BART LAB joined the Asian Conference on Computer-Aided Surgery (ACCAS 2025), hosted by Kyushu University Medical School, Japan, where leading researchers from across Asia convened to discuss advancements in medical robotics and computer-assisted interventions.

Assoc. Prof. Dr. Jackrit Suthakorn, Director of BART LAB and Board Member of the Asian Society of Computer-Aided Surgery (ASCAS), represented Thailand at the annual board meeting and the conference.

Dr. Nantida Nillahoot (Nui Nan), Innovation Director of BART LAB, was invited to deliver a talk in the prestigious “Rising Star Session.” Her presentation, “SurgySym – A Surgical Training Simulator from Research to Product,” highlighted BART LAB’s translational research journey from academic innovation to real-world surgical training applications. Two legendary pioneers in the field—Prof. Makoto Hashizume (Japan) and Prof. Dong-Soo Kwon (Korea)—attended the session, marking an inspiring milestone for Thai biomedical innovation.

Also joining from Thailand was Ms. Chavisa Suppuang, an M.D.-M.Eng. student from Mahidol–Ramathibodi, who presented her research paper at the conference. Prof. Kovit Khampitak from Khon Kaen University and members of the Thai Medical Robotics and AI Association also participated, reflecting Thailand’s growing presence in the Asian medical robotics community.
